Four Individuals Plead Guilty to Arson Attack on Jewish Charity Ambulances

An arson attack Jewish ambulances has resulted in four guilty pleas following a serious incident that took place in Golders Green, a residential area located in north-west London. The incident, which occurred during March, targeted four vehicles belonging to a community-based charitable organization, resulting in significant damage and explosive consequences.

Details of the Incident

The arson attack Jewish community services occurred when four charity-operated ambulances were deliberately set on fire in the Golders Green locality. The deliberate ignition of these vehicles caused multiple explosions, creating a dangerous situation that could have resulted in severe injuries or fatalities. Emergency services responded swiftly to contain the situation and investigate the criminal activity.

These ambulances were critical assets for the Jewish charitable organization, providing essential emergency medical transportation and response services to community members. The destruction of these vehicles represented not only a financial loss but also a disruption to vital healthcare services provided to vulnerable populations within the community.

Criminal Accountability and Legal Proceedings

The investigation into the arson attack Jewish ambulances led to the identification and apprehension of four suspects. Each of the four individuals involved in the incident subsequently appeared before the courts and entered guilty pleas to charges related to arson. This swift legal resolution followed a thorough investigation conducted by law enforcement authorities who worked diligently to identify those responsible for the criminal acts.

The guilty pleas represent an acknowledgment by the defendants of their involvement in deliberately setting fire to the vehicles. Such admissions expedited the judicial process and ensured that justice could be served without the need for lengthy trial proceedings.
